Transaction 8500d2b575537fc77cc0b167340231d8cea5684fb5f9e1de3132d93fcf936c4e

1 Input
2 Outputs
  • 8500d2b575537fc77cc0b167340231d8cea5684fb5f9e1de3132d93fcf936c4e:0
  • value  14632719
    address  1FGk2XFSUZ9LAKwPHwYJCW3qRTRFoe1zM3
  • 8500d2b575537fc77cc0b167340231d8cea5684fb5f9e1de3132d93fcf936c4e:1
  • value  132452904
    address  19mhSzR87b79mFUQNrEJHbhv23SWCjf3Hk